VL BPC 100… Valueline configurable box PC Data sheet 3063_en_E 1 © PHOENIX CONTACT 2013-07-16 Description The VL BPC 1000 is a configurable box PC that can be mounted either directly on a wall or on a DIN rail. The VL BPC 1000 utilizes the Intel® Atom™ N455 1.66 GHz CPU, chosen for its balance of processing power and energy efficiency. The small footprint, fanless design and rich I/O capability make the VL BPC 1000 a product that can be used in a wide variety of applications. The three built-in COM ports enable connections to legacy RS-232 devices. One of the COM ports can also be configured for RS-422 or RS-485 protocols. 2 – – – – – – Features Energy-efficient Intel Atom processors Fanless design DIN rail- and wall-mounting options CompactFlash (CF) support Embedded operating system support Three COM ports The VL BPC 1001 is built on the exact same platform as the VL BPC 1000. While the VL BPC 1000 is configurable, the VL BPC 1001 has a fixed configuration that does not include a CompactFlash® card or operating system. DIN rail mounting A B 155 mm (6.10 in) Figure 1 6 Dimensions Installation The VL BPC 100… can be mounted on an NS 35 DIN rail or attached to a flat mounting surface such as a wall (mounting method must be selected when ordered). Be sure sufficient clearance exists for routing cables to the connectors. When installing the VL BPC 100… in a cabinet, follow these general rules: – Verify clearances within the cabinet. Typically, leave at least 5 cm (2 in.) on each side. Depending on cable routing, additional space may be required. – Drill all holes and make all cuts before beginning installation. Be sure to protect already installed components from shavings. – Supporting panels must be at least 14 gauge to provide proper support. – Make sure that there is adequate space around the heat sink (on the back of the VL BPC 100…) and air inlets and outlets to provide sufficient cooling. Secure the VL BPC 100… to the wall using appropriate hardware. PHOENIX CONTACT 4 VL BPC 100… 7 Interfaces After mounting the VL BPC 100…, make any necessary cable connections. RS-232/422/485 ERROR RUN VGA 1 2 6 3 7 4 8 PWR Power X9: COM 5 X10: COM X1: PWR 24VDC X11: COM 1 10 6 15 11 X8: VGA X6: USB X7: USB X4: USB X5: USB USB Figure 3 CF 5 9 X3: ETH X2: ETH Ethernet Connectors The connections available are: – Ethernet (ETH): Two RJ45 connectors allow the computer to communicate on a 10/100/1000 Base-T Ethernet network. – Serial (COM): Three 9-pos. D-Sub ports allow connection of serial devices. Two ports operate on the RS-232 layer; one port can be configured to communicate on the RS-232, RS-422 or RS-485 physical layer (see “Serial communication” on page 7 for jumper settings). – USB (USB): USB devices connect using Type A connectors. The VL BPC 100… has four USB ports. – VGA (VGA): This port connects the VL BPC 1000 to an external analog display with a corresponding VGA connector. 7.1 Service panel NOTE: Electrostatic discharge! Jumpers on the circuit board provide the ability to configure the VL BPC 100… for specific applications. To access the jumpers: 1. Turn off the VL BPC 100… and disconnect the power supply. 2. Remove the VL BPC 100… to an ESD safe location. External display External analog displays can be connected to the VGA port of the VL BPC 100… (see Figure 3). An Extended Display Identification Data (EDID) display will download its capabilities to the display driver while non-EDID displays will not. In either case, additional settings can be applied through the Intel® Graphics Media Accelerator. 3063_en_E PHOENIX CONTACT 5 VL BPC 100… 3.
